Insider Buying: AMREP Co. (NYSE:AXR) Major Shareholder Acquires $57,512.00 in Stock

AMREP Co. (NYSE:AXRGet Free Report) major shareholder James H. Dahl acquired 2,800 shares of AMREP stock in a transaction dated Monday, March 25th. The shares were acquired at an average cost of $20.54 per share, with a total value of $57,512.00. Following the completion of the acquisition, the insider now directly owns 346,365 shares in the company, valued at approximately $7,114,337.10. The purchase was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is accessible through the SEC website. Major shareholders that own more than 10% of a company’s stock are required to disclose their sales and purchases with the SEC.

AMREP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

AMREP Corporation, through its subsidiaries, primarily engages in the real estate business. The company operates through two segments, Land Development and Homebuilding. It sells developed and undeveloped lots to homebuilders, commercial and industrial property developers, and others. In addition, the company owns mineral interests covering an area of approximately 55,000 surface acres of land in Sandoval County, New Mexico; and owns oil, gas, and minerals and mineral interests covering an area of approximately 147 surface acres of land in Brighton, Colorado.
